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

ASPÖÐʹÓÃXMLHTTP»òServerXMLHTTP¶ÁȡԶ³ÌÊý¾Ý

ÕÕÀýʹÓÃxmlhttpͬ²½·½Ê½»ñÈ¡Êý¾Ý,¿ÉÊÇÓÉÓÚÍøÂç²»Îȶ¨,¾­³£Ôì³É'ËÀËø'×´¿ö,¼ÈsendÖ®ºóÒ»Ö±²»·µ»Ø·þÎñÆ÷½á¹û,Ò²²»³ö´í.
±»Õâ¸öÎÊÌâÕÛÄ¥Á˺þÃ,×îºó²Å²éµ½»¹ÓÐServerxmlHTTPÕâ¸ö¶ÔÏó,¿´Á˽éÉܲÅÖªµÀËü²ÅÊÇÌìÉúΪÁË·þÎñÆ÷¶Ë»ñÈ¡ÆäËûÍøÕ¾ÐÅÏ¢Éè¼ÆµÄ.ÀûÓÃËûµÄ³¬Ê±»úÖÆ£¬ÎÊÌâÇáËɽâ¾ö:D
²Î¿¼£º
http://support.microsoft.com/kb/290761/zh-cn
http://msdn.microsoft.com/library/default.asp?url=/library/en-us/xmlsdk/html/97884cf6-5fdf-4b1f-8273-73c0e098b8f3.asp
ÏÂÃæ¸¶¼òµ¥·â×°ÁËServerxmlHTTPµÄ¼òµ¥Àà,¹²²Î¿¼:
<%
'ʹÓ÷¶Àý
'¶ÁÈ¡URL µÄHTML
dim myHttp
set myHttp=new xhttp
myHttp.URL="http://www.baidu.com"
Response.Write(myHttp.html)
'±£´æÔ¶³ÌͼƬµ½±¾µØ
myHttp.URL="http://www.baidu.com/img/logo.gif"
myHttp.saveimage="myfile.gif"
'Ϊ·ÀÖ¹xhttp¿¨ËÀµÄÇé¿ö£¬Ê¹Óó¬Ê±£¬´íÎó´¦Àí
dim sHtmlcode,iStep
myHttp.URL="http://www.acnow.net"
sHtmlcode=myHttp.html
do while myHttp.xhttpError=""
Response.Error("ERROR: AGAIN!
")
sHtmlcode=myHttp.html
iStep=iStep+1
if iStep>100 then
Response.Write("ERROR:OVER!
")
exit do
end if
loop
Response.Write(sHtmlcode)
set myHttp=nothing
'--------------------------------------------------------------------
Class xhttp
private cset,sUrl,sError
Private Sub Class_Initialize()
'cset="UTF-8"
cset="GB2312"
sError=""
end sub
Private Sub Class_Terminate()
End Sub
Public Property LET URL(theurl)
sUrl=theurl
end property
public property GET BasePath()
BasePath=mid(sUrl,1,InStrRev(sUrl,"/")-1)
end property
public property GET FileName()
FileName=mid(sUrl,InStrRev(sUrl,"/")+1)
end property
public property GET Html()
Html=BytesToBstr(getBody(sUrl))
end property
public property GET xhttpError()
xhttpError=sError
end property
private Function BytesToBstr(body)
on error resume next
'Cset:GB2312 UTF-8
dim objstream
set objstream = Server.CreateObject("adodb.stream")
with objstream
.Type = 1 '
.Mode = 3 '
.Open    
.Write body  '
.Position =


Ïà¹ØÎĵµ£º

asp»ñÈ¡ipµØÖ·

Õª×Ô£ºhttp://shawangkun.woku.com/article/2723424.html
×î¼òµ¥µÄÓÃÒÔÏÂÓï¾ä:
ip=request.ServerVariables("REMOTE_ADDR")
response.Write(ip)
µ«ÕâÖÖ·½·¨¶Ô´úÀí·þÎñÆ÷ÉÏÍøµÄ¾Í²»×¼ÁË,¹Ê±È½ÏÈ«ÃæµÄÊÇÓÃÏÂÃæµÄ·½·¨:
<%Private Function getIP()
Dim strIPAddr
If Request.ServerVariables("HTTP_X_FORWARDED_F ......

asp¶ÁÈ¡Îı¾ÄÚÈÝ

'**************************************************    
'º¯ÊýÃû£ºFSOFileRead    
'×÷ ÓãºÊ¹ÓÃFSO¶ÁÈ¡ÎļþÄÚÈݵĺ¯Êý    
'²Î Êý£ºfilename ----ÎļþÃû³Æ    
'·µ»ØÖµ£ºÎļþÄÚÈÝ    
'************** ......

ASPдµÄÅúÁ¿µ¼³öIISÓòÃûÁбí

×î½ü¹À¼ÆºÜ¶àÈ˶¼Åöµ½ºÍÎÒͬÑùµÄÎÊÌ⣬¾ÍÊÇÒòΪɨ»Æ¼°±¸°¸¹ÜÀí·Ç³£ÑÏ£¬Ò»¸öû±¸°¸Ö±½Ó¹Ø·þÎñÆ÷£¬Ò»¸ö»ÆÕ¾Ö±½Ó·â»ú·¿¡£ÏÖÔÚÍøÕ¾ËùÓÐÓòÃû±ØÐèͨ¹ý±¸°¸£¬ÒÔǰ»¹Ëɵ㡣µ«ÎÒÃÇ·þÎñÆ÷100¶à¸ö£¬×ܲ»ÄÜÒ»¸öÒ»¸ö¼ì²é°É£¬ÉÏÍøËÑÁËÏ£¬Óиö³ÌÐòÉÔºÏÊÊ£¬µ«µ¼³öµÄÊÇÍøÕ¾ÓòÃûÕ¾µãÃû£¬ÎÒÐÞ¸ÄΪµ¼³öÓòÃûÁÐ±í£¬Í¬Ê±½â¾öÁ˵¼³öÒ»¸öÕ¾µã°ó¶¨¶à¸ ......

ASPÖÐDictionary¶ÔÏóµÄÒ»¸öÆæ¹ÖÎÊÌâ

Ê×ÏÈÌù´úÂ룺
<%@LANGUAGE="VBSCRIPT" CODEPAGE="936"%>
<%
Dim objDic
Dim arr(2)
arr(0) = 0
arr(1) = 1
arr(2) = 2
Set objDic = Server.CreateObject("Scripting.Dictionary")
objDic.Add "key",arr
Response.Write("ÕâÊÇÐÞ¸Ä֮ǰµÄÖµ£º" & objDic.Item("key")(0))
objDic.Item("key")(1) = ob ......

asp utf 8 Í·ÎļþÊý¾Ý¿âÁª½Ó³Ø

 <%@Language="VBScript" CodePage="65001"%>
<% option explicit%>
<% on error resume next %>
<% Session.CodePage="65001" %>
<% response.charset="utf-8" %>
<%
dim conn,connstr,sql,rs,rs2,rs3
connstr="dbq=" & server.MapPath("../data091003/data09 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